The Art Of Etching Sheet Metal

etching sheet metal is a process that involves using a combination of chemicals and a design template to create intricate patterns and designs on metal surfaces. This technique has been used for centuries to add decorative elements to various metal objects, from jewelry and household items to industrial components and signage.

The process of etching sheet metal begins with selecting a suitable piece of metal to work with. Copper and brass are commonly used due to their softness and ability to react well to etching chemicals. The metal sheet is then cleaned thoroughly to remove any dirt, grease, or other impurities that may interfere with the etching process.

Next, a design template is created using either a digital design software or hand-drawn directly onto a sheet of transfer paper. The design is then transferred onto the prepared metal sheet using a transfer medium such as heat or pressure. This transfers the design onto the metal surface, creating a guide for the etching process.

The metal sheet is then coated with a layer of acid-resistant material, such as wax or a specialized etching resist. This resist is applied to areas of the metal sheet that are to remain untouched by the etching chemicals, protecting them from being etched away. The exposed areas of the metal sheet are then ready to be etched.

The etching process involves submerging the metal sheet into a bath of etching solution, typically a mixture of acids such as nitric acid or ferric chloride. The acids react with the unprotected metal surface, eating away at the metal and creating the desired design. The length of time the metal sheet is left in the etching solution will determine the depth and intricacy of the design.

After the desired etching depth is achieved, the metal sheet is removed from the etching solution and thoroughly rinsed with water to stop the etching process. The resist material is then removed from the metal surface, revealing the intricate design that has been etched into the metal sheet.

Once the resist is removed, the metal sheet may be further processed to enhance the design. This can include polishing the metal surface to remove any remaining oxidation or residue from the etching process, or adding additional finishes such as patinas or sealants to protect the metal and enhance its appearance.

In addition to its decorative applications, etching sheet metal also has practical uses in various industries. For example, etched metal plates are commonly used for signage, nameplates, and labeling in industrial settings due to their durability and professional appearance. Etched metal components are also used in electronics, aerospace, and automotive industries for their precision and performance.
